How to choose a gaming headset: start with comfort
Clamping force, cushion material, and weight determine whether a headset is still comfortable three hours into a session, which matters more day to day than any audio spec.

Clamping force is the pressure a headband applies to hold the ear cups against your head, and it is the single biggest reason a headset that felt fine in a five-minute store demo turns into a headache by the third match. Too loose and the seal breaks, letting outside noise in and bass leak out; too tight and it presses on glasses arms or just aches. There's no universal number that works for everyone here, since head shape and glasses change the math, which is exactly why a longer at-home trial beats judging fit in a showroom.
Cushion material changes the story too. Mesh fabric breathes better and stays cooler through a long session, while faux leather seals sound in more tightly but traps heat against the ear. Weight matters in a way that's easy to underestimate: a headset that feels light on a shelf can feel noticeably heavier after two hours, especially if the weight sits unevenly toward the front where the mic boom attaches.
If you're shopping specifically for gaming, look for models built with padded headbands and swappable cushions, since those are the parts that wear out and the parts you can actually replace instead of rebuying the whole headset. Headphones gaming setup: headset or headphones plus a separate mic?
A headset bundles a microphone with the headphones; the mic is the entire difference, and it's worth deciding on purpose rather than by default.
This is the headphones vs headset question that trips up a lot of first-time buyers, and the honest answer is that the two categories overlap almost completely except for one part. A gaming headset adds a built-in microphone, usually a boom or detachable arm, to a pair of headphones; strip that mic away and the electronics doing the actual audio work aren't fundamentally different. That means the choice mostly comes down to whether you need to talk while you play.
For anyone who voice-chats regularly, in squad games, raids, or party calls, a dedicated gaming headset is the simpler answer: one device, one connection, a mic already positioned correctly. For solo or single-player gaming where voice chat rarely happens, a good pair of general headphones can sometimes edge out a similarly priced headset on pure audio, since a headset splits its price between speaker drivers and microphone hardware instead of putting everything into sound. It's also worth knowing that a headset's mic quality varies enormously by design. Boom and detachable mics, which sit an inch or two from your mouth on an adjustable arm, generally capture cleaner voice than the small inline or hidden mics found on general-purpose wireless headphones repurposed for gaming. If clear team communication is the priority, that boom-mic detail is worth checking before anything else on the spec sheet.
Wired, 2.4GHz wireless, or Bluetooth: what changes with each
Wired and 2.4GHz USB-dongle connections keep audio lag effectively at zero, while classic Bluetooth can introduce a noticeable delay; newer Bluetooth LE Audio with the LC3 codec narrows that gap without fully closing it in most gaming headsets yet.
A wired connection sends signal with no meaningful processing delay, which is why wired headsets remain the safe default for competitive play where a fraction of a second matters. The tradeoff is the cable itself: it limits how far you can move and adds one more thing to snag on a chair.
Most gaming-specific wireless headsets sidestep classic Bluetooth's biggest weakness by using a dedicated 2.4GHz USB dongle instead of phone-style Bluetooth pairing. That dongle connection is built for low, consistent latency rather than battery efficiency or universal compatibility, which is exactly the tradeoff competitive gaming rewards. Classic Bluetooth audio, by contrast, was designed around phone calls and music, not split-second reaction games, and it shows.
Bluetooth's newer LE Audio standard, built around the LC3 codec, is a real step forward. According to the Bluetooth SIG, listening tests found LC3 delivers better audio quality than the older SBC codec even at half the bit rate, while also cutting power use, which is a meaningful upgrade for battery-powered wireless audio generally. It's a codec improvement more than a latency guarantee, though, and most gaming headsets on the market still lean on 2.4GHz dongles rather than LE Audio for the actual low-lag connection. If a headset offers both a 2.4GHz mode and a Bluetooth mode, the 2.4GHz mode is almost always the one to use for gaming, saving Bluetooth for calls or a backup connection when the dongle isn't handy.
Surround sound: what makes a good gaming headset sound accurate, not just big
Virtual surround sound (7.1, Dolby Atmos for headphones, DTS:X) simulates directional audio through two drivers using software, and it can help immersion in story-driven games while sometimes working against precise footstep detection in competitive shooters.
Gaming headsets almost universally use two physical drivers, one per ear, the same setup as ordinary stereo headphones. What gets branded as 7.1 or virtual surround sound is software that manipulates timing and frequency between those two drivers to simulate sounds coming from behind or beside you, rather than actual extra speakers built into the ear cups. That's a meaningful distinction: it's a processing effect layered onto stereo hardware, not a hardware upgrade.
Whether that processing helps depends heavily on the game. In competitive, footstep-driven shooters, plain stereo often locates a sound's left-right position more reliably than virtual surround does, because the added processing can introduce artificial reverb that muddies exactly the split-second directional cue a player is listening for. In slower, atmosphere-heavy or story-driven games, the same processing tends to add a genuine sense of space, footsteps overhead, explosions behind you, that stereo alone doesn't deliver.
The quality gap between different brands' virtual surround implementations is also large; some sound convincingly spatial, others sound washy or artificial. Most headsets that offer the feature let you toggle it off entirely, which is worth doing before assuming surround sound is automatically the better setting. What makes a good gaming headset here isn't the surround branding on the box, it's whether you can switch between stereo and surround depending on what you're playing, and whether the surround mode sounds clean rather than smeared when you do turn it on.
Comfort for long sessions and protecting your hearing while you play
Long gaming sessions raise the same volume-and-duration risk that applies to any headphone use, and pairing a well-sealed, comfortable headset with a sane volume habit does more for your ears than any single spec.
Gaming sessions run long in a way a lot of other headphone use doesn't; a weekend raid or ranked grind can stretch for hours with the volume never really dropping. That combination of duration and loudness is exactly what hearing-health guidance warns. The World Health Organization's safe-listening guidance ties risk to both volume and time together, recommending device volume at or below 60% of maximum, and separately estimates that over a billion young people are at risk of permanent hearing loss from unsafe personal listening habits, a number worth remembering the next time the in-game volume slider creeps up to drown out a noisy squad call.
A well-sealed headset with real passive isolation, snug ear cups, a good cushion seal, actually helps here in a very practical way: you're not fighting background room noise by pushing volume higher just to hear game audio clearly. That's arguably a stronger case for spending on fit and build quality than any single audio spec, since comfortable, well-isolated headphones make it easier to stay at a safer volume without even trying.
This also loops back to comfort in a literal sense. A headset that clamps too hard or traps heat encourages shorter sessions, which isn't a bad thing for your ears even if it wasn't the intended benefit. If long sessions are the norm, treating breathable cushions and a lighter clamp as safety features, not just comfort ones, is a reasonable way to think about it.
Platform compatibility and what to check before buying
Check that a headset's connection type actually matches your platform, since PC, PlayStation, Xbox, and Switch each handle wireless audio differently, and a headphones buying guide that skips this step leads to returns.

A 2.4GHz USB dongle needs a free USB port, which most gaming PCs and current consoles have, but a laptop with limited ports or a console dock setup can make that dongle inconvenient even when it's technically compatible. Bluetooth headsets pair easily with PC and Nintendo Switch's Bluetooth-enabled models, but older Xbox consoles historically lacked native Bluetooth audio support, so a Bluetooth-only headset can leave an Xbox player stuck without a wired fallback.
Wired headsets sidestep most of this with a standard 3.5mm jack or USB connection that basically every platform accepts, part of why wired remains the simplest cross-platform choice. If a headset advertises multi-platform support, check whether that claim covers wireless mode on every platform you own, or only the wired connection; those are two different compatibility claims often blurred into one line of marketing copy.

Platform quirks aside, the short version of how to choose a gaming headset comes down to the same handful of checks every time: comfort for the length of your sessions, a connection type your platform actually supports without a workaround, and a microphone built for the way you play. Surround branding and RGB lighting are worth comparing last, once those basics are settled.
